Default Help picking cat back/cut out combo for Big Cam

Hello


I am trying to decide what catback cut out combo to go with, I have no problem building a custom system with separate mufflers but I need to get the car quieter than it is now, I would like to have the cutout so I can get loud and rowdy at times and get the flow when needed.

Right now I have a custom Off Road Y pipe (that is rotting and needs to be replaced) Slp LT headers and a Borla Mouth ( SLP Loudmouth with bullet swapped to Borla XR1) It sounds great at idle other than leaks from Y pipe but sounds shitty when full throttle or just cruising, it drones and is too raspy for me.

here is the H/C/I info
- Patriot LS6 Heads 64cc
- Speed Inc Cam 238/244 .605/.612 110 LSA
- LS6 Intake

Magnaflow, Magnaflow, Magnaflow. i cant believe how quiet it is!! i have LTs ORY and i have tried no mufflers, stock catback, flowtech catback and finally magnaflow catback..this thing is VERY tame! at idle it is absolutley quiet! it get loud above 3k-4k rpm which works out for me. i think with a cam it would rock. keep this updated.
